Three Inmates Accused of Jail Assault

The Monmouth County Sheriff's Office confirms three men face charges for allegedly attacking another inmate.

Three men incarcerated at Monmouth County Correctional Institution are accused of attacking another inmate last month.

Orthis K. Allen, 20, Malik Edwards, 19, and James Reed allegedly assaulted a 25-year-old male on Sunday, Sept. 30, according to arrest warrants.

The men used a sharpened object, the origin of which is unknown, to attack the inmate, causing injuries to his face and neck, the warrant states.

Allen, Edwards and Reed have been charged with aggravated assault, complicity and unlawful possession of a weapon, Monmouth County Sheriff’s Office Public Information Officer Cynthia Scott confirmed.

Allen was remanded to MCCI after he was . During the incident, Allen allegedly forced his way into an Avenue A home and assaulted a man in the residence. His bail, originally set at $75,000, has been raised to $195,000 following to assault accusations.

Edwards was put into custody at the jail in January after he was arrested on robbery and assault charges in Ocean Township, according to Monmouth County Sheriff’s Office records. His $60,000 bail has been raised to $180,000.

Information on Reed’s age and the original charge he was incarcerated on was not immediately available.
